What is Global Molybdenum Carbide Powders Market?

The Global Molybdenum Carbide Powders Market is a niche yet significant segment within the broader materials science industry, focusing on the production and distribution of molybdenum carbide (Mo2C) in powder form. This material is renowned for its exceptional properties, including high hardness, excellent wear resistance, and superior chemical stability, making it a critical component in various industrial applications. Molybdenum carbide powders are primarily utilized in the manufacturing of hard metals and ceramics, as well as in catalysis and surface coating processes. The market's value, pegged at US$ 79 million in 2023, underscores its importance in sectors demanding materials that can withstand extreme conditions. The anticipated growth to US$ 106.3 million by 2030, with a compound annual growth rate (CAGR) of 3.6% from 2024 to 2030, reflects increasing demand across diverse industries, from aerospace to electronics, where the unique properties of molybdenum carbide powders can lead to significant advancements in product performance and durability. This growth trajectory is supported by ongoing research and development efforts aimed at enhancing the quality and applicability of molybdenum carbide powders, ensuring their relevance in future technological innovations.

Coating Material, Metal Material, Aerospace, Others in the Global Molybdenum Carbide Powders Market:

The usage of Global Molybdenum Carbide Powders spans several critical areas, including coating material, metal material, aerospace, among others, showcasing the material's versatility and high performance. As a coating material, molybdenum carbide powders offer exceptional hardness and wear resistance, making them ideal for protective coatings in tools and machinery, which significantly extends the life and efficiency of these components. In metal materials, the powders are used to enhance the strength and durability of metals, providing critical improvements in high-stress applications such as automotive and industrial machinery. The aerospace sector benefits from the high-temperature stability and corrosion resistance of molybdenum carbide, utilizing these powders in the manufacture of engine components and other critical aerospace parts that require materials capable of withstanding extreme conditions. The "others" category encompasses a wide range of applications, from electronics, where the powders are used in semiconductor manufacturing, to energy, where they contribute to the development of more efficient and durable energy storage systems. The broad applicability of molybdenum carbide powders across these areas is a testament to their unique properties, including high hardness, chemical stability, and thermal conductivity, which are essential in meeting the demands of modern technology and manufacturing processes.
